<P>PROBLEM TO BE SOLVED: To perform speed sensorless vector control to an induction motor. <P>SOLUTION: The speed sensorless vector control device comprises an excitation current command value operation means 21, a torque current command value operation means 22, a current control means 23, a γ-δ/three-phase coordinates transformation means 24, an integrator 25, a three-phase/γ-δ coordinates transformation means 26, a magnetic flux estimation means 27, a slip frequency & primary frequency estimation means 28, and the like for separating the primary current and voltage of the induction motor 2 to γ-axis and δ-axis components for controlling independently. By using the magnetic flux estimation means 27 and the frequency & primary frequency estimation means 28, for example, even if the primary frequency reaches or becomes closer to a zero frequency, for example when the induction motor 2 shifts from a regenerative state to a braking one; more accurate slide frequency estimation values and primary frequencies of the induction motor 2 are obtained. <P>COPYRIGHT: (C)2008,JPO&INPIT |
